RoleClimate17 are working exclusively with a global renewable energy business who carry out operations and maintenance services to large-scale solar farms across the UK.They are actively searching for a Regional Manager to oversee the successful day-to-day operations on their PV portfolio in North Lincolnshire, Leicestershire, Nottinghamshire, Yorkshire and Derbyshire.Requirements
  • Responsible for the daily operational and HR line management of the site-based technical staff including annual appraisals, all disciplinary and absence-based protocols for the field technicians with the region.
  • Deliver effective HSE leadership at all times in order to enhance the organisation’s commitment to safety performance.
  • Coach and guide Lead Technicians, Junior and Site Technicians with thin the region.
  • Support the O&M Coordinator in compiling the annual PPM schedule.
  • Understand the company’s detailed obligations in respect of any ongoing or ad hoc works on sites in the region.  Ensure, monitor and audit compliance with those obligations
  • Take regional responsibility for plant performance, work quality and site appearance (both electrical, landscaping and other) across sites within the area.
  • Support the O&M Coordinator to update and schedule the works using FRM.
  • Performing PPM (inc. HV) to ensure the successful ongoing operation of the plants.
  • Ensure that all reporting is submitted in a professional, complete and timely manner
  • Assist in the onboarding of new sites, including leading side due diligence and onboarding visits, filling in reports and / or forms, and creating onboarding documentation.
  • Be aware of and support with spare parts / inventory matters on the sites and ensure that spare parts stock records are always up to date.
  • Ensure teams have the correct PPE equipment, vehicles and training
  • Support in the recruitment of new field staff
  • Assist Project Managers and Procurement Manager with quoting for works.
  • Supporting operational responsibility by ensuring and improving in-team profit margins
  • Carry out new joiner inductions; successful onboarding and coaching of new field staff.
Requirements
  • C&G / NVQ Level 3 Electrician
  • BS 7671 - 18th Edition.
  • C&G 2391 inspection & testing or AM2 (preferred). 
  • HV Trained (AP15/OP40) and provide evidence via personal switching log book.
  • 3+ years’ experience working on utility scale solar farms in an O&M / Project role.
  • Key inverter manufacturer trained (SMA, ABB, Power Electronics etc.)
  • IOSH Managing Safely.
  • Line Management experience preferred but not essential.
  • Full UK driver’s license
